35 Saint Michel church, Ile-aux-Moines

Back to France: here is a very small church in Britanny. It is situated on the Ile aux Moines, which has only just over 600 inhabitants, but gets a lot of tourists in the summer, mostly cycling around the island before eating grilled fish in the restaurants. Anyway, the church has a lovely clock tower and some exquisite little features inside, and you can see from the noticeboard what parish activities are a priority.
